Scotland v Czech Republic, 14 June 2021 | Hampden Park, Glasgow
Total allocation - 1,972 standard seat tickets
Available to members with 14 Loyalty Points and above from 10am Friday, 21 May

England v Scotland, 18 June 2021 | Wembley Stadium, London
Total allocation - 2,655 standard seat tickets
Available to members with 12 Loyalty Points and above from 10am Friday, 21 May

Croatia v Scotland, 22 June 2021 | Hampden Park, Glasgow
Total allocation - 1,940 standard seat tickets
Available to members with 14 Loyalty Points and above from 10am Friday, 21 May

The tickets are digital now, so you access your tickets through the Euro 2020(21) app. Whoever bought the tickets can transfer ownership of them to someone else but they have to do that through the app. Whoever has official ownership of the tickets needs to show ID when entering the stadium.
